目的 : 探讨一氧化氮合酶 (NOS)和血管内皮生长因子 (VEGF)在结节性红斑中的表达。方法 :用ABC免疫组化方法检测了 4 2例结节性红斑患者皮损和 15例正常人皮肤组织中NOS和VEGF。结果 :结节性红斑皮损中NOS和VEGF的检出率分别为 80 .95 %及 6 6 .6 7% ,阳性信号的表达与分布基本一致(χ2 =2 .2 2 <3.84 ,P >0 .5 ,u =0 .36 6 <0 .6 78,P >0 .5 ) ,主要位于表皮角质层和部分棘细胞、真皮及皮下脂肪层小血管内皮细胞和腺上皮细胞内 ,正常人皮肤组织中NOS和VEGF的表达微弱 ,分布于表皮角质层和部分棘细胞 ,真皮及皮下脂肪层未见。结论 : 结节性红斑皮损中有NOS和VEGF的强阳性表达 ,可能与病毒等微生物引起的免疫反应有关。
Objective:To measure the expression of nitri c oxide synthase (NOS) and vascular endothelial growth factor (VEGF) in patients with erythema nodosum. Methods: The expression and distribu tion of NOS and VEGF were detected by ABC immunohistochemistry technique in 42 c ases of erythema nodosum and 15 healthy controls. Results: In the group of patients,the detection rates of NOS and VEGF were 80.95% and 66 .67% respectively,and the positive expression and distribution were almost the same (χ 2=2.22<3.84,P>0.5,u=0.603<0.678,P>0.5),mainly in the stratum corneoum,parts of prickle cell layer of the epidermis,dermis and micro vascular endothelial cells and glandular epithelium of subcutaneous tissues. The expression of both NOS and VEGF were weak in healthy controls,mainly in parts of prickle cell layer and stratum corneoum of the epidermis,and no positive sig nal was found in dermal and subcutaneous tissues. Conclusion : Both NOS and VEGF were strongly expressed in erythema nodosum. This mayb e related to immunoreactivity of some microorganism infection such as virus,etc .
